Near Trail Camp, NW of Cone Peak, Big Sur (Monterey County, California, US)family
Papaveraceae
synonyms Dicentra chrysantha
plant community Along trail in dense Ceanothus chaparral and Mixed Oak/Pine Woodland, approximately 5 years after major fire.notes One can see the inflorescence is a cyme, i.e. the flowers mature from the center outwards.camera Shot at f8, 1/60 on a Canon D60 w/ a Canon 50mm Compact macro lens.
